KR KR20250044513A
The present invention relates to a drone take-off and landing apparatus for article delivery support, which comprises: a solar panel for collecting sunlight to generate power; an article storage box disposed adjacent to the solar panel; a main body frame attached to an outer surface of a high-rise building, supporting the solar panel and the article storage box, and having an inner space at the same time; an independent power supply device located in the inner space and generating and supplying driving power through the generated power of the solar panel; a location broadcasting device located in the inner space and broadcasting a landing GPS location in a long-range wireless communication method or a landing altitude in a short-range wireless communication method; a tag wireless reader located in the inner space and reading a tag attached to a delivery article in a wireless manner; an article transfer device for moving the delivery article from the solar panel to the article storage box; and a control device for notifying an article receiver terminal of the completion of article delivery in the short-range wireless communication method and activating the operation of the article transfer device at the same time when the tag is read.
